H A D | log.h | 2e9eeaa1 Fri Dec 13 08:10:51 CST 2019 Bob Peterson <rpeterso@redhat.com> gfs2: eliminate ssize parameter from gfs2_struct2blk
Every caller of function gfs2_struct2blk specified sizeof(u64).
This patch eliminates the unnecessary parameter and replaces the size calculation with a new superblock variable that is computed to be the maximum number of block pointers we can fit inside a log descriptor, as is done for pointers per dinode and indirect block.
